Pasadena’s Past
The area where Pasadena sits, in fact the entire San Fernando Valley, was once occupied by Native Americans. In 1771, the Spanish arrived and established the San Gabriel Mission. Orchards and vineyards were planted and flourished. Soon, Mexico took control of the land from Spain, dividing the land between many individuals. Control of this area was retained by Mexico until California became a state in 1852.
Some Great Things to See
Although you could make the drive into L.A. or Hollywood, there is much to see in Pasadena. The city has many museums for adults, as well as children. The Norton Simon Museum, the Pacific Asia Museum and Kidspace are but a few examples. A short drive in your Rental car will take you to the beautiful Angels National Forest. Should you choose to spend some time shopping, the best place to go is South Lake Avenue. There you will find shops of all kind, providing shoppers with some great items. In fact, many items can be found only in this area. If you are interested in science, you can visit the Jet Propulsion Laboratory. Owned by NASA, it continues to remain involved in all space missions. Should you want to simply spend some time exploring downtown Pasadena, take a walk down Ellis Street. To get some additional ideas, visit the Pasadena Convention Center and Visitors Bureau. They can provide some great ideas. Yes, you will find plenty to do and see without ever leaving Pasadena.
